Transaction 23e28139be1563217683aea8bb312f94399d728a9ee4108ab0bc8632e2991166

2 Input
2 Outputs
  • 23e28139be1563217683aea8bb312f94399d728a9ee4108ab0bc8632e2991166:0
  • value  116655865
    address  1HwkvGR5N1XCHGAPEV78R8F435T87zQpKT
  • 23e28139be1563217683aea8bb312f94399d728a9ee4108ab0bc8632e2991166:1
  • value  309458983
    address  3JR4nSU3NQC5Yr8y1MEvG28NAidnjXcmdW